arm64: dts: st: Use 128kB size for aliased GIC400 register access on stm32mp25 SoCs

Adjust the size of 8kB GIC regions to 128kB so that each 4kB is mapped 16
times over a 64kB region.
The offset is then adjusted in the irq-gic driver.

see commit 12e14066f4 ("irqchip/GIC: Add workaround for aliased GIC400")
